Sicily: A promising vintage for red and white wines at Gulfi

Sicily: A promising vintage for red and white wines at Gulfi

Giampaolo Motta

First indications from Cantina Gulfi, the Azienda Agricola which created the grand crus in Sicily (NeroMaccarj, Nerobufaleffj, Nerosanlore, Nerobaronj) may indicate the 2010 vintage is a great vintage in this part of Europe. “On september 7th, we already picked some white grapes including Caricanti” said Vito Catania, the owner of this organic wine estate. “Up to now, we had perfect conditions, it rained much during the winter and then, from june to end of august, a lovely sunny weather with reasonable temperature. We may start harvesting our grand crus in the third week of september. Grapes are beautiful, ripe, and maturity went well with cool weather (even sometimes a bit cold) over a longer period than last year (1 week later). Regarding Resecca, our wine made with 100 years old vines planted on Etna, it is too early to talk about the harvest even if the grapes are developping very well. Maybe October 10th, but let’s see up to this time…”
